An Electronic Control Module (ECM) is a sophisticated computer system that plays a role in the operation of automotive systems by processing data from various sensors and controlling actuators to manage the vehicle’s performance. In the context of modern heavy-duty trucks, ECMs are integral to ensuring efficient engine operation, optimizing fuel consumption, and meeting stringent emissions standards. Functionality of the Cummins 3403087RX ECM
The Cummins 3403087RX ECM operates as the central processing unit within the truck’s system. It collects data from an array of sensors distributed throughout the engine and other critical components. This data is then analyzed to make real-time adjustments to the engine’s performance. The ECM controls various actuators to regulate fuel injection, ignition timing, and other parameters that influence engine efficiency and emissions. By continuously monitoring and adjusting these factors, the Cummins 3403087RX ECM ensures that the engine operates within optimal parameters under varying conditions 2.

Integration with Other Systems
The Cummins 3403087RX ECM is designed to interact seamlessly with other truck systems, such as the transmission, braking system, and driver assistance technologies. This integration allows for a cohesive driving experience, where the ECM works in concert with these systems to optimize performance and safety. For example, by communicating with the transmission control module, the ECM can adjust engine parameters to ensure smooth gear changes and efficient power delivery. Similarly, integration with braking systems allows for enhanced control during deceleration, improving both safety and fuel efficiency 5.
Diagnostic and Monitoring Capabilities
The Cummins 3403087RX ECM is equipped with robust diagnostic tools and monitoring features. These capabilities enable technicians to identify issues promptly, perform maintenance tasks efficiently, and ensure optimal truck performance. The ECM can store di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s) that indicate specific problems within the engine or related systems. Additionally, it provides real-time data on engine parameters, allowing for proactive maintenance and the prevention of potential issues 6.

Maintenance and Care
To ensure the longevity and consistent performance of the Cummins 3403087RX ECM, regular maintenance and care are recommended. This includes keeping the ECM’s software up to date to benefit from the latest improvements and bug fixes. Environmental protections, such as ensuring the ECM is shielded from moisture and extreme temperatures, are also crucial. Proper handling procedures during installation or removal can prevent physical damage to the sensitive electronic components within the ECM 8.
